@article{article_412889, title={The Effects of Different Nitrogen Levels on Shoot and Root Growth of Hybrid Maize Genotypes}, journal={Akdeniz University Journal of the Faculty of Agriculture}, volume={9}, pages={94–100}, year={1996}, author={Samancı, Bülent}, keywords={Azot, Genotip, Mısır}, abstract={<p>The effects of different nitrate concentrations (0, 0.05, 0.50, 0.75 and 1 mol m-3 NO-3) on five maize hybrid genotypes were studied. The root and shoot growth depended on the genotype and concentration of NO-3 in the nutrient solution. Increase of NO-3 concentrations in the nutrient solution significantly reduced the root length to 24.34 cm whereas, weight did not increased accordingly. Highest root weight was obtained at 0.05 NO-3 level. The genotypes reacted differently to the increase of NO-3 concentration in the nutrient solution in shoot and root length but not with the weight. Root and shoot length and weight ratio as well as root/shoot ratios were independent from nitrogen concentration for the hybrid genotypes. With increasing nitrogen levels, cells in roots were also changed from 90 to 38, 5 μ in length and 15 to 8.12 μ in vvidtb. This study could be useful for screening hybrid genotypes for the efficient use of nitrogen. </p>}, number={1}, publisher={Akdeniz Üniversitesi}
